  • *Job Responsibilities**

As a Statistical Modeling and Predictive Analytics Specialist at arenaflex, you will be responsible for:

  • Applying statistical modeling and predictive analytics techniques to drive business growth and improve operational efficiency
  • Developing and implementing statistical models to analyze complex data sets and identify trends and patterns
  • Collaborating with cross-functional teams to identify business needs and develop solutions that meet those needs
  • Presenting findings and recommendations to senior leadership and other stakeholders
  • Developing and maintaining complex statistical models and predictive analytics algorithms
  • Assisting in the development of data visualizations and reports to communicate insights and findings to non-technical stakeholders
  • Escalating issues and roadblocks as they occur and working with the team to resolve them
  • Interacting with internal and external stakeholders to provide semi-regular data updates and insights
  • *Essential Qualifications**
  • Bachelor's degree in a quantitative field such as mathematics, statistics, computer science, or engineering
  • Strong knowledge of statistical modeling and predictive analytics techniques, including regression analysis, time series analysis, and machine learning algorithms
  • Experience with data visualization tools and techniques, including Tableau, Power BI, or D3.js
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to communicate complex ideas and results to non-technical stakeholders
  • Experience with programming languages such as R, Python, or SQL
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to work accurately and efficiently in a fast-paced environment
  • *Preferred Qualifications**
  • Master's degree in a quantitative field such as mathematics, statistics, computer science, or engineering
  • Experience with big data technologies such as Hadoop, Spark, or NoSQL databases
  • Experience with cloud-based platforms such as AWS or Azure
  • Certification in a statistical modeling or predictive analytics tool such as SAS or SPSS
  • Experience with data governance and data quality best practices
